## PedalShift Service Accounts

Welcome aboard! PedalShift is our rebalancing tool that tells the van crews which docks in Larkmoor need bikes moved. It runs under the `pedalshift-rebalance` service account, which talks to the Dock Census API every five minutes. Don't use your personal login for scripts — always use the service account, or alerts get attributed to you at 3am. Sounds fun, right? To get started locally, export the key shown below into your shell.

service key, tadup-tahog: zpat7_wB1tnEL

### Step 4: Sign the scrubber bundle

After PixelRinse finishes stripping EXIF metadata from the release image set, verify the scrub report shows zero residual GPS tags before proceeding. Do not skip this check — an unsigned or unscrubbed bundle will be rejected by the gate. Sign the bundle with the deploy key below.

release key, hadug-kawef: bky13_mPGeFZeR1GZ1G

Heads up: we flipped a few solver defaults after the Northgate Academy pilot. Room-clash penalties are now weighted harder than teacher-gap penalties, which matches what every school actually asked for. The annealing schedule also starts cooler, so first-pass timetables look sane instead of chaotic. If you pinned the old defaults, nothing changes for you — but fresh installs will behave differently, so don't panic when regression snapshots shift. New installations of the solver now start with the following configuration values.

service settings:
[casax]
port = 6379
team = rusir
host = casax.zemvarhq.corp
region = outer-4
access_code = ac_9808ce
timeout_ms = 1500

## Releases

Pagination in the Fernwhistle public REST API is cursor-based as of v3. Offset parameters are rejected with a 400. Reviewers: check that any new list endpoint returns a `next_cursor` field and caps page size at 100. Breaking pagination changes require a major version bump and a migration note in the changelog. Release tarballs for the API gateway are signed at cut time with the key below.

release key, fajef-kajeg: bky19_LdLu6Ne6FLi8he2c24d

TURN-208: Gatevale turnstile counters at the Merrow Field pilot double-count when a rotation reverses mid-cycle. Attendance totals drift roughly 2% high per event. The debounce window fix is implemented, reviewed by Ilsa, and soak-tested across two simulated match days without drift. Ready for your cut; the candidate build is identified below.

trace token, tagag-tafog: htk6_5ed18c